Application areas
The BGK systems are especially suited for the following products:
Flat bread
Pre-product for breadcrumbs
Pitta
Pizza
Oven bottom rolls/buns
Rolls/buns on trays
Oven bottom loaves
Oven bottom sticks (Sliced wheat and wheat mixed bread)
Executions
One-level (BGK-E) – box on floor
Multi-level (BGK-M) - box or on intermediate platform
Features
Frame construction in stainless steel
Closed sections
Belt types individually to customer requirements
Circulation climate control
Separated clime zones controlled by sluices possible (according to technological requirements, proofing resp. stiffen)
Insulation panelling in sandwich construction according to necessary fire regulations
Standardized components
PLC control
Cleaning, stripper (for dough carrier conveying system with brushes, to wash at regular intervals, BGK-E brush)
Continuous belt (BGK-E)
Maintenance corridor (BGK-E), min. one-sided
Belt tracking (BGK-E)
Continuously running (BGK-E)
Intermittently running (BGK-M)
Dough carrier conveying system (BGK-M)
Single belts per loading step (BGK-M), easy to change
Accessible on both sides, illuminated, possibly with platform (BGK-M )

Circulation climate control
Heating via
Warm water
Low pressure saturated steam; 0,2 – 0,5 bar pressure above atmospheric (105 – 113°C)
Electrical heater coils
Gas burner

Advantages
Easy control (little sensors and actuators)
High standard of hygiene through closed sections
Low maintenance
Mono system (one product, one proofing time) BGK-E
Variable system, also for small batches (BGK-M)
Different proofing times possible (BGK-M)
Space saving (compact design) (BGK-M)
Multiple products simultaneously producible (BGK-M)
Easy belt change (BGK-M)
No belt tracking necessary (BGK-M)
High plant availability (BGK-M)
